WebPost-operative cleft repair care tips After the cleft repair surgery, it is important to follow proper post-operative care, especially in the first three weeks. During this time, the repair may not be strong enough to resist possible damage caused by fingers and other foreign objects in the mouth. WebYour child’s palate is repaired with dissolving stitches, but the repair is delicate for several months after surgery. In order for the repair to heal well, you and your child should avoid putting anything hard in the mouth. WebA common cause of postoperative fever is an inflammatory or hypermetabolic response to an operation. Other causes include pneumonia, urinary tract infection (UTIs), wound infections, and deep venous thromboses (DVTs).
